Choose the fire alarm tool by the circuit question

Use this matrix before the full tool table when listed equipment data is available but the first NFPA 72 calculator is not obvious.

Project questionBasis to have readyOpen firstThen verify with

Battery standby and alarm capacity

NFPA 72 workflow

Listed standby current, alarm current, standby duration, alarm duration, and aging margin basis.Fire Alarm Battery Capacity Calculator Fire Alarm Battery and NAC Worksheet

NAC load and spare capacity

NFPA 72 workflow

Appliance count, listed current at selected setting, power supply rating, and spare-capacity target.NAC Circuit Load Calculator Fire Alarm Battery and NAC Worksheet

End-of-line voltage check

NFPA 72 workflow

Wire size, circuit current, one-way route length, source voltage, and listed minimum device voltage.Fire Alarm NAC Voltage Drop Calculator AWG Wire Resistance Table for Fire Alarm Circuits

Conductor resistance basis

NFPA 72 workflow

AWG size, circuit current, one-way length, source voltage, and minimum voltage for the same circuit.Fire Alarm Wire Resistance Calculator Fire Alarm NAC Voltage Drop Calculator

Detector or strobe layout screen

NFPA 72 workflow

Listed detector spacing, ceiling/environment factors, room dimensions, and selected candela.Detector Spacing Calculator Strobe Candela Coverage Calculator
